Abstract
Background: To explore the relationship between the preoperative immune inflammation index (SII) and the prognostic nutritional index (PNI) and the overall survival rate (OS) of patients with alveolar hydatid disease.Entities:
Keywords: hepatic hydatid; overall survival; prognostic factors; prognostic nutritional index; system immune inflammation index

Figure 1Kaplan Meier survival curves for OS according to inflammation-based scores in hepatic hydatid patients. (A) patients with SII > 758.92 × 109/L had worse prognosis than patients with SII ≤758.92 × 109/L (P < 0.001). (B) patients with PNI > 42.275 had longer OS than patients with PNI ≤ 42.275 (P < 0.001). (C) patients with PLR > 178.145 had shorter OS than patients with PLR ≤ 178.145 (P < 0.001). (D) patients with NLR > 2.695 had worse prognosis than patients with NLR ≤ 2.695 (P < 0.001).

Figure 2Kaplan–Meier survival curves for OS according to the combination of SII and PNI in hepatic hydatid patients. The 5-year OS rates for patients with coSII-PNI = 0, 1, and 2 were 23.5%, 47.6%, and 79.3%, respectively (p < 0.001).
Figure 3The AUC of SII, PNI, PLR, NLR and COSII-PNI were 0.670(95%CI: 0.601-0.738), 0.638(95%CI: 0.561-0.716), 0.642(95%CI: 0.568-0.715),0.618(95%CI: 0.541-0.684) and 0.688(95%CI: 0.616-0.760) and respectively Compared with SII or PNI alone, we found that COSII-PNI has the highest AUC, which indicates that COSII-PNI is the most accurate prognostic indicator for predicting survival rate among these inflammatory indicators, and can be used as a tool for evaluating the prognosis of patients with hepatic alveolar echinococcosis.
